DNA digital data storage is the process of encoding and decoding binary data to and from synthesized strands of DNA. While DNA as a storage medium has enormous potential because of its high storage density, its practical use is currently severely limited because of its high cost and very slow read and write times.

In DNA data storage, the four nucleotide bases (A, C, G, T) store and encode data. Information is stored in permutations of three nucleotides bases, called codons. DNA storage comprises three processes: coding the data, synthesizing and storing it, and decoding it.
